The Peoria Riverfront Museum is a unique multidisciplinary museum in the United States, with a mission to inspire confidence, lifelong learning, and talent through art, science, history, and achievement. Since its establishment in 2012, the privately funded museum has provided nearly one million experiences to visitors through major exhibitions, a permanent collection, interactive galleries, a dome planetarium, and a giant screen theater. Moreover, it offers educational programming, including curricula-related experiences for students of all ages. The museum, which is accredited by the American Alliance of Museums (AAM) and affiliated with the Smithsonian Institution, has garnered support from over 4,000 members and donors. Housed in a LEED Gold-certified building on a campus overlooking the Illinois River, the Peoria Riverfront Museum has positioned itself as a significant cultural and educational landmark.
